EIB Microscopy Facility has following instruments: 1) Abberior STEDYCON super-resolution (STED) microscope; 2) Zeiss LSM 880-NLO confocal / two-photon system; 3) Yokogawa CSU-W1 spinning disck confocal microscope and 4) Zeiss AxioObserver Z1 wide field microscope.
